What are the default scan settings for detecting and cleaning a virus?

0

By default, Sophos AV for remote users will detect a virus and prevent that file from being accessed until the user defines the action setting to clean or delete the file. Sophos AV is not set the same as a computer that is associated to the ACU campus network domain (employee computers). Computers that are part of the campus network domain are centrally managed and are set to automatically clean/delete any incoming viruses automatically.The Sophos AV for the remote user has more flexibility in setting the action preferences when a virus is detected. The same settings that are mandated for campus computers are not mandated to the remote user s computer. The default action setting is set to detect the virus and restrict access to the infected file (form of quarantine).
